Medallion Financial Corp.

DB:MD5 Stock Report

Market Cap: €200.4m

Medallion Financial Ownership

Who are the major shareholders and have insiders been buying or selling?


Recent Insider Transactions

DB:MD5 Recent Insider Transactions by Companies or Individuals
DateValueNameEntityRoleSharesMax Price
10 Sep 24Buy€37,505Anthony CutroneIndividual5,500€6.83

Insider Trading Volume

Insider Buying: MD5 insiders have bought more shares than they have sold in the past 3 months.


Ownership Breakdown

What is the ownership structure of MD5?
Owner TypeNumber of SharesOwnership Percentage
Individual Insiders4,832,99521.8%
Institutions7,036,90331.7%
General Public10,321,40646.5%

Dilution of Shares: Shareholders have not been meaningfully diluted in the past year.


Top Shareholders

Top 25 shareholders own 46.75% of the company
OwnershipNameSharesCurrent ValueChange %Portfolio %
10.1%
Andrew Murstein
2,244,743€20.3m0%no data
7.94%
Alvin Murstein
1,762,026€15.9m0%no data
5.43%
BlackRock, Inc.
1,205,048€10.9m13.3%no data
4.89%
The Vanguard Group, Inc.
1,084,181€9.8m1.59%no data
3.62%
Tieton Capital Management, LLC
802,926€7.3m-0.29%3.51%
1.88%
Geode Capital Management, LLC
416,956€3.8m2.42%no data
1.23%
Stifel Asset Management Corp.
272,949€2.5m4.19%no data
1.09%
GAMCO Investors, Inc.
242,000€2.2m0%0.01%
1%
David Rudnick
222,277€2.0m0%no data
0.98%
American Century Investment Management Inc
216,698€2.0m15.6%no data
0.96%
Connor, Clark & Lunn Investment Management Ltd.
213,477€1.9m32.2%0.01%
0.92%
State Street Global Advisors, Inc.
204,558€1.8m0.66%no data
0.91%
Donald Poulton
202,106€1.8m0%no data
0.65%
Bridgeway Capital Management, LLC
143,423€1.3m1.13%0.02%
0.64%
Northern Trust Global Investments
142,113€1.3m255%no data
0.57%
Segall Bryant & Hamill, LLC
125,938€1.1m0%0.01%
0.57%
BNY Asset Management
125,794€1.1m-10.7%no data
0.54%
Two Sigma Advisers, LP
120,200€1.1m-11.1%no data
0.47%
De Lisle Partners Llp
103,545€935.0k26.5%0.15%
0.43%
O'Shaughnessy Asset Management, LLC
96,226€868.9k-3.39%0.01%
0.41%
Two Sigma Investments, LP
91,555€826.7k-27.3%no data
0.41%
Marshall Wace LLP
90,145€814.0k-34.7%no data
0.38%
Teton Advisors, LLC
85,000€767.5k-3.41%0.29%
0.37%
LSV Asset Management
81,400€735.0k0%no data
0.35%
David Haley
78,422€708.1k1.57%no data